false
false

Address Details

0x704ee15AFe87130f51E2ed34a87a72590A855913

Balance
1.410768907485776007 ETH ( )
Tokens
Fetching tokens...
Transactions
156 Transactions
Transfers
268 Transfers
Gas Used
17,923,399
Last Balance Update
101408712
Connection Lost, click to load newer transactions

Transactions

There are no transactions for this address.